Key Considerations Before You Start
Knowing Your Product and Target Market
Before you even send out supplier inquiries, be crystal clear on your product specs, ideal price points, and what your audience actually wants.
Researching Product Demand
Use tools like Google Trends, Amazon Best Sellers, or Alibaba’s Hot Products to find out if your product has real demand.
Legal and Import Regulations
Make sure your product isn’t banned or heavily restricted in your country. And always calculate the landing cost, not just the product price.
Finding the Right Suppliers in China
Where to Begin Your Search
-
Alibaba
-
Made-in-China
-
1688 (for local Chinese prices)
-
Trade Shows (like Canton Fair)
Online Platforms vs Sourcing Agents
Online platforms offer convenience, but sourcing agents like Supply Base Solutions bring in-depth local knowledge and do the heavy lifting.
Vetting Suppliers for Quality and Reliability
-
Request business licenses and certifications.
-
Ask for sample products.
-
Check online reviews and request references.

Communication and Language Barriers
How to Effectively Communicate with Chinese Suppliers
Keep it simple. Use short sentences, avoid slang, and be super clear with product specifications.

Shipping and Logistics
Choosing Between Sea Freight and Air Freight
-
Sea Freight: Cheap but slow.
-
Air Freight: Fast but pricey.
Duties, Taxes, and Customs Clearance
Factor in import duties and local taxes. Ask your sourcing agent for a full cost breakdown to avoid surprises.
Common Pitfalls to Avoid
-
Don’t get blinded by low prices. Quality matters.
-
Avoid suppliers with no physical address or verified business info.
-
If a deal sounds too good to be true—it probably is.
Tips for First-Time Importers
-
Start Small: Test the waters with a small batch.
-
Check Everything: From samples to certifications.
-
Build Relationships: Trust grows over time—don’t rush.

1. What is the Minimum Order Quantity (MOQ) when ordering from China?
MOQ varies by product and supplier, but typically starts from 100 to 500 units. Supply Base Solutions can help negotiate lower MOQs.
2. How long does shipping from China usually take?
Sea freight takes 25–45 days, while air freight is around 5–10 days depending on your location.

4. What payment methods are recommended?
Use secure methods like PayPal for small orders, or Trade Assurance via Alibaba. For larger deals, T/T (bank transfer) with a partial upfront payment is standard.
